2What you'd actually use

The tools this job runs on, and how well you'd need to know each one.

nCino / Abrigo Sageworks (Loan Origination System)Advanced

Configuring complex deal structures, managing intricate workflows, training junior staff on platform usage, and troubleshooting data integrity issues. You'll be pushing the system to its limits.

Moody's Analytics CreditLens / Excel (Financial Spreading Software)Expert

Building custom projection models, adjusting for non-recurring items across multiple entities, analysing complex multi-entity cash flows, and using Power Query for advanced data import and manipulation. You're the go-to person for complex modelling.

Salesforce Financial Services Cloud (CRM)Advanced

Creating complex reports and dashboards to track pipeline velocity, conversion rates, and overall client relationship exposure. You'll be using the CRM to inform your deal strategy and identify cross-sell opportunities.

SharePoint / Laserfiche (Document Management)Advanced

Managing document checklists and exceptions for complex deals, auditing files for completeness and compliance ahead of internal and external reviews. You'll ensure our documentation is bulletproof.

Fiserv Premier / Jack Henry Symitar (Core Banking Platform)Intermediate

Understanding how loan data from the LOS posts to the core system. Investigating and resolving discrepancies in balances or payment applications, especially for complex or syndicated loans.

Tableau / Power BI (Business Intelligence)Advanced

Connecting to diverse data sources to build sophisticated dashboards that visualise individual loan performance, track covenant compliance, and present portfolio-level insights to management.

4How you'll be judged

The scoreboard, honestly: the hard targets, how often each one is actually looked at, and the quiet human signals that never make it onto a dashboard.

First-Pass Approval Rate
Percentage of Credit Approval Memoranda (CAMs) that get approved by the Credit Committee without needing significant revisions or further information on the first submission.
Target · >85%

If you submit 10 CAMs and 9 are approved with only minor tweaks, that's a 90% first-pass rate. It shows you've done your homework and presented a solid case.

Portfolio Quality (Assigned Loans)
Monitoring the performance of a sub-portfolio of existing loans you're involved with, specifically looking at past-due rates and risk rating migration.
Target · <1% past-due rate; <10% risk rating downgrades annually

Your assigned loans total £50M. If only £250K are 30+ days past due, you're well within target. If only 3 of 50 loans are downgraded in a year, that's good.

Deal Cycle Time (Complex Loans)
Average number of days from receiving a complete loan application package to final Credit Committee approval for complex deals you lead.
Target · <30 days

You take on 5 complex deals in a quarter. If the average approval time is 28 days, you're hitting the mark. This shows efficiency, even with tricky cases.

Mentorship Effectiveness
The readiness and independent capability of junior analysts you've mentored to take on more complex underwriting tasks.
Target · At least one junior analyst ready for independent underwriting of £1M+ loans per year.

Your mentee, after 9 months, successfully underwrites a £1.5M CRE deal with minimal oversight and a strong CAM. That's a win.

What frustrates people
  • The 'Garbage In, Garbage Out' Problem: Receiving incomplete, messy, or obviously manipulated financial statements from borrowers and spending 50% of your time just cleaning the data before analysis can even begin.
  • Sales vs. Risk Tension: Constant pressure from Relationship Managers to 'make the deal work' and stretch policy for a risky borrower, forcing you to be the 'bad guy' who upholds credit standards.
  • Credit Committee Whiplash: Spending weeks meticulously underwriting a deal, only to have it derailed in committee by a single executive's 'gut feeling' or a question you couldn't possibly have anticipated.
  • The Documentation Black Hole: The endless, non-negotiable chase for paperwork (insurance certs, title policies, entity docs) that holds up a closing, with you caught between an impatient client and a rigid closing department.
  • Legacy Tech Limbo: Fighting with a 15-year-old core system and clunky software that requires manual workarounds and double data entry, killing productivity and adding to your workload.

7What you need before you start

Not a wish list. The things you would be expected to already have.

  • Proven track record of independently underwriting and structuring complex commercial loans (typically £2M+) in a banking or financial institution setting.
  • Demonstrable experience presenting and defending credit recommendations to a formal Credit Committee or senior management.
  • Strong understanding of accounting principles and financial statement analysis, including cash flow modelling and projection techniques.
  • Experience mentoring or guiding junior analysts, including providing constructive feedback and technical support.
  • Advanced proficiency in at least one major Loan Origination System (e.g., nCino, Abrigo Sageworks) and financial spreading software (e.g., Moody's CreditLens, advanced Excel).

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ance) Risk Integration

ESG factors are no longer just for 'green' funds; they're becoming critical to assessing long-term credit risk and regulatory compliance. Clients are increasingly judged on their ESG performance, and so are banks. Understanding how to integrate these non-financial risks into your credit analysis will be essential.

  • Materiality Assessment
  • ESG Data Sources & Metrics
  • Transition Risk vs. Physical Risk
  • Green Loan Principles

Where it leads next, rung by rung

Where it leads

The career path, and where it branches

Lead Commercial Lending Specialist is a start, not a ceiling. Each step below asks for new skills and hands back more autonomy.

  1. Commercial Lending Manager

    3-5 years as a Lead Commercial Lending Specialist

    This is a step into formal people management and broader departmental oversight.

    • Portfolio Strategy: Developing and executing strategies for managing the overall health and growth of a significant loan portfolio.
    • Operational Excellence: Driving process improvements and technology adoption across the entire lending function.
    • Regulatory Liaison: Acting as a key point of contact for internal and external auditors/regulators.
  2. Principal Commercial Lending Specialist (Individual Contributor)

    3-5 years as a Lead Commercial Lending Specialist

    This is a deeper specialisation, often with enterprise-wide influence, without formal direct reports.

    • Credit Policy Design: Contributing directly to the creation and revision of the bank's credit policies and procedures.
    • Specialised Market Expertise: Developing deep expertise in a niche lending market (e.g., structured finance, venture debt, specific industry sectors).
    • Complex Transaction Advisory: Acting as an internal consultant for the most challenging and innovative loan transactions.

Automated Financial Spreading

Imagine AI tools that can read those messy PDF tax returns and financial statements, automatically extracting and populating data directly into Moody's Analytics CreditLens or your Excel templates. This means you'll spend far less time on tedious data entry and more time on actual analysis. It's a game-changer for efficiency.

Anomaly & Trend Detection

Our AI systems can analyse historical financial data and instantly flag unusual variances, potential signs of fraud, or early indicators of a covenant breach. This focuses your attention on the highest-risk areas of a deal or portfolio, letting you dig into the 'why' instead of hunting for the 'what'.

Pre-Analysis Research Assistant

Before you even start underwriting, use an AI assistant to instantly summarise the latest industry trends, competitor performance, and recent news related to a potential borrower. This gives you crucial context for your credit memo narrative and helps you spot macro risks quickly, saving hours of manual research.

Credit Memo First Draft

AI can generate the objective, data-driven sections of your Credit Approval Memorandum (CAM)—things like company history, financial ratio analysis, and collateral summaries—based on the spread data you've already input. This means you can focus your expertise on the subjective analysis, the 'story' of the deal, and your final recommendation, rather than starting from a blank page.
